What is the probability of tossing two heads
vodka [1.7K]

Hello!

Each time, there will be a 1/2 chance of tossing a head. Therefore, we multiply our two probabilities.

1/2(1/2)=1/4

Therefore, we have a 1/4 or 25% chance of tossing two heads in a row.

1/3 x + 1 = 5/6 x - 3
mr Goodwill [35]

Answer:

x=8

Step-by-step explanation:

Step 1: Subtract 5/6x from both sides.

1/3x+1−5/6x=5/6x−3−5/6x

−1/2x+1=−3

Step 2: Subtract 1 from both sides.

−1/2x+1−1=−3−1

−1/2x=−4

Step 3: Multiply both sides by 2/(-1).

(2/−1)*(−1/2x)=(2/−1)*(−4)

x=8
